Korea’s Catering Firms Pivot Beyond B2B as 6 Trillion‑Won Market Stalls

Major Korean contract catering companies—Samsung Welstory, CJ Freshway, Hyundai Green Food and others—are expanding beyond traditional B2B meal services as the domestic group-meal market stalls around the 6 trillion won level. While 3Q results improved for top players, structural limits (population decline, remote/hybrid work, few new large workplaces) constrain long-term growth of onsite corporate, school and hospital catering. Firms are diversifying into private‑brand (PB) products, ready meals, subscription services, care food for seniors/patients, online retail, and overseas airline catering. Examples: CJ repackaged its PB “Itswell” and grew online sales—children’s brand “Ainuri” juices rose 223% YoY—while Ourhome’s online mall revenue jumped 66% with faster delivery options. Ourhome also supplies up to 15,000 airline meals daily from its U.S. unit, and Hyundai Green Food’s care‑food brand “Greeting” sells hundreds of health‑focused ready meals via subscription. Analysts say this shift responds to long‑term trends—aging society, demand for healthier food, and online purchasing—pushing catering firms to become broader food‑tech and lifestyle players.
